When I start playing the violin it's like the whole world around me disappears.

"As if anything were possible for Christmas I would ask for two things. For me not to be sad all the time and for the love I have now to be with me forever. (...) Most of the time I'm sad sort of half and half - for no reason and with a reason. The biggest reason is just loneliness and that, in my earlier school people made fun of me."

Maya, 12 years old

Every autistic person has talent. Every single one!

Talents can be different just as people are different. For some it's singing or dancing, for others it's memorizing maps or keeping track of the weather forecast. Unfortunately, the talents of autistic people often go unsupported. They go unnoticed, unappreciated and wasted.

Each of these talents can be an opportunity for a happy life. But without support, it won't be possible. Sometimes it just takes one good enough person. One who will notice the talent of an autistic person and help it to develop.
